- [ ] **Step 7: Breaker override escrow.** After sealing the signing keys for the Tallgrove upstream API circuit breaker, confirm the support team can force the breaker open during a full outage. The override bundle lives in the sealed escrow drawer and is useless without its unlock phrase. Two ceremony witnesses must initial this step before proceeding. The escrow bundle is decrypted with the recovery passphrase that follows.

vault phrase of kahip-kahop = holath-quenmir

CI note: PixelHoard image cache leaking on the nightly soak job. Heap grows ~40MB/hr; suspect eviction listener holding decoded frames. Mitigation: restart the cache pod and cap soak duration to 4h until the fix lands. Do not bump the cache size — it masks the leak. Repro is pinned to the failing build, referenced below.

trace token, fafog-kageg: htk4_98e6

Ticket: Staging queue misconfiguration after Hopwell migration

Summary: We replaced the homegrown `taskpump` job queue with Corvid Queue last sprint, but staging was never fully migrated. Jobs enqueued by the invoice mailer are silently dropped because `QUEUE_BACKEND` still reads `taskpump` in `staging.env`. Please update it to `corvid` and confirm `QUEUE_REGION=north-2` is present. Corvid also requires a broker credential to authenticate the worker pool, which must appear on the very next line of the file.

env line for bagap-yajep: COURIER_KEY20=b4db4e5e33a646898766

Starting with this release, the Thistledown monitoring stack ships with the read-replica lag alarm enabled by default. Previously the alarm had to be switched on per tenant, which meant several support escalations arrived only after customers noticed stale reads themselves. The new default fires a warning at a lower lag threshold and a page at the critical threshold, with a short dampening window to suppress blips during maintenance. Support staff triaging lag tickets should reference the default settings below.

config for yajep-tafof:
[rusath]
team = julmir
access_code = ac_fe37fd
host = rusath.novactech.test
port = 8000
owner = pelmir.weneth
peer = oliwyn.olvarqdyn.internal